## Read-replica lag alarm keeps tripping in CI

Hey folks — if you see the `replica-lag-high` alarm during integration runs on Copperfen, don't panic. The test database spins up a replica that takes a minute or two to catch up, and the alarm threshold fires before it settles. It's noisy, not broken. Quick fix: add the `wait-for-replica` step before your migration tests, or just rerun the stage once. A proper fix landed recently; check whether your pipeline is on the build listed below.

build token for kahop-kagep: htk6_72fc45

Subject: Prototype workshop access — week of the Halloway build review

Hello all,

The front desk will be coordinating access to the prototype workshop on Level B1 while the Halloway review runs. Team assistants: please send us your visitor lists by noon the day before, and remind guests that bags are checked in at the desk. Workshop tours are capped at six people and must finish by 16:30. The workshop door has its own reader, separate from the lifts, and uses the code below.

Thanks,
Front Desk, Ostermere Campus

door code, yagap-bahof: bdg-O-05

- [ ] Step 7: Archive cold storage buckets (Glacierline tier). Confirm both ceremony witnesses are present, verify bucket manifests match the Oxbow ledger, then seal the archive key shares. Plugin authors may observe but not handle shares. Once sealed, the archive index itself is encrypted and can only be reopened with the passphrase below.

vault phrase of badup-hahig = tamael-aldael-kelmir-istael-fenok-istwyn-tamius-jorath-oliion

## 4.2.0 — Changed Defaults

Sort in the Larkspur report builder is now stable by default. Previously, rows with equal keys could reorder between runs, which broke snapshot diffs in QA. Stable sort costs ~8% more memory on large exports; acceptable. If you maintain custom report plugins, drop any workaround tie-breaker columns — they're redundant now. Unstable sort can still be forced per-report, but don't. New installs pick this up automatically. Upgraded environments should verify the following values.

config for kajog-tadug:
[casax]
port = 11211
region = west-3
host = casax.nelvroworks.internal
timeout_ms = 5000
retries = 7